  • Covingtons Convalescent Center Description

    Covington's Convalescent Center and Rehabilitation Facility is A Long Term Care Facility Offering Comprehensive Rehabilitation and Skilled Nursing Care for Medicare, Medicaid, & Private Pay Residents.

    Covington's has served Hopkinsville and surrounding counties for 45 years. We currently are certified for 72 Long Term, Skilled Medicare, Medicaid, and Private Pay Resident Beds. Private Rooms and Semi-Private Rooms

    Health and Fire Safety Deficiencies

    The Center for Medicare and Medicaid report health and fire safety deficiencies. Some of these deficiencies are more severe than others. The following table shows different levels of severity.

    Scope
    Severity of Deficiency Isolated Pattern Widespread
    Immediate jeopardy to resident health or safety J K L
    Actual harm that is not immediate jeopardy G H I
    No actual harm with potential for more than minimal harm that is not immediate jeopardy D E F
    No actual harm with potential for minimal harm A B C
